Transaction e05f491019a9e03dfda18611c4268558b24ab9a59c4b2894144c76181afed8c8
1 Input
1 Output
-
e05f491019a9e03dfda18611c4268558b24ab9a59c4b2894144c76181afed8c8:0
- value
- 626291
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71c789c581afb3367e0f71787555f00aa8d82573 OP_EQUAL
- address
- 3C4dKNk6HHrDbKXnEoU23hxdptUwgBx6RJ